BitcoinWorld Japanese Yen Under Pressure: Intervention Risks and BoJ Policy in Focus, HSBC Says The Japanese yen remains under significant pressure as markets weigh the likelihood of official intervention against the broader policy trajectory of the Bank of Japan (BoJ). Analysts at HSBC have weighed in on the dynamics, highlighting that while intervention risks persist, the central bank’s policy stance remains the more critical factor for the currency’s medium-term direction.
HSBC’s View on Yen Intervention Risks According to HSBC’s research note, the threat of Japanese authorities stepping into currency markets to support the yen is real, particularly if the USD/JPY pair moves sharply higher. However, the analysts argue that intervention alone is unlikely to reverse the yen’s fundamental weakness.
